B. Gilmore Obituary

B. Preston Gilmore, age 89, of New Preston, CT and Boca Raton, FL, passed away on Dec. 10, 2012. He was the husband of Marilyn (Adam) Gilmore.
Born in North Providence, R.I., on October 20, 1923, he was the son of the late Frank and Mae (Preston) Gilmore. He graduated from LaSalle Academy in Providence, R.I., Manhattan College with a BEE degree, and Rutgers University with an MBA.
Preston was a 1st Lieutenant with the Army Engineers during World War II. He was the retired owner of WWYZ-FM, WATR-AM, and WATR-TV in Waterbury, and WNAB-AM in Bridgeport, CT.
Most of Preston's life was spent living between New Preston, CT., Boca Raton, FL., and more recently Nevada and California. Preston was an avid golfer and a member of the Lake Waramaug Country Club, Royal Palm Yacht and Country Club, and the Delray Beach Club. He enjoyed traveling the world with family and friends.
In addition to his wife, Marilyn, he is survived by two sons, Mark T. Gilmore of Southbury and Steven P. Gilmore of Woodbury; two daughters, Susan Geiger of Waitsfield, VT, and Jacquelyn M. Cloherty of Waltham, MA., nine grandchildren and one great -grandchild. He was predeceased by an infant son, Gregory, his first wife of more than 50 years, Florence (Dolly) (Thomas) Gilmore and his brother Robert Gilmore of Harwichport, MA.
